Picking the Perfect Plants for Your Landscape
How can one select the most suitable plants for a landscape? Choosing the right plants starts with a thorough understanding of the local climate and soil conditions. Since various plants flourish in different environments, understanding hardiness zones and soil pH levels is essential. Additionally, considering sunlight exposure—whether full sun, partial shade, or full shade—helps in choosing appropriate species.
Another key consideration is the planned function of the landscape. For example, decorative plants can improve visual appeal, while native species can foster biodiversity while needing less care. It's also necessary to consider the growing patterns and dimensions of plants to guarantee they fit harmoniously within the space.
Finally, thinking about seasonal variation—through foliage, flowers, or bark—allows for a vibrant landscape year-round. Through the integration of these components, you can establish a landscape that is beautiful, sustainable, and highly functional.

Ways to Keep Your Landscape Flourishing All Year Long?
Preserving a vibrant landscape throughout the year requires regular upkeep and dedication. Seasonal changes can greatly impact plant health, making it essential to customize upkeep methods based on seasonal demands. Consistent irrigation, especially during dry spells, allows plants stay properly hydrated. Mulching helps retain moisture and suppress weeds, while seasonal pruning encourages healthy growth and flowering.
Fertilization needs to be modified based on individual plant requirements and seasonal patterns. During spring, a well-balanced fertilizer encourages healthy growth, while applying fertilizer in fall can ready plants for the coming winter. Furthermore, keeping a close watch for pests and diseases is critical; identifying issues early can help avoid extensive damage.
Weeding ought to be performed regularly, as it reduces competition for nutrients and water. Furthermore, adding native plants can boost overall resilience, as such species thrive naturally in regional conditions. By implementing these practices, property owners can maintain a vibrant landscape that stays attractive and robust across all seasons.

Water Conservation Techniques
Proper water conservation methods are fundamental to sustainable landscaping practices. Landscaping services support sustainability by utilizing techniques such as drip irrigation and rainwater harvesting. Drip irrigation systems supply water straight to plant roots, reducing evaporation and runoff. Additionally, professional landscapers often design rain gardens that absorb excess rainwater, reducing the need for supplemental irrigation. Mulching is yet another approach utilized to maintain soil moisture and inhibit weeds, further boosting water efficiency. By choosing drought-hardy plants, landscaping services can establish vibrant, low-water landscapes that prosper in diverse climates. These practices not only conserve water but also contribute to lower utility costs and healthier ecosystems, ensuring that landscapes remain sustainable and resilient in the face of changing environmental conditions.
